What state did Wilma Rudolph grow up in?

Wilma Goldean Rudolph was born and raised in Clarksville, Tennessee.

Why are they important in history Wilma Rudolph?

Wilma Rudolph was the first American woman to win three gold medals in track and field events at the Olympics. She tied the world record in the 100-meter and set a new Olympic record in the 200. This was at the 1960 Olympic games in Rome, Italy.
